    7. Numerical simulation of the rotational molding process

    7.1 Flow of the reactant mixture

    The simulation of reactive rotational molding when the initial mixture is in the liquid state (pre-gel phase) requires accounting of fluid flow, of heat transfer and of the polymerization reactions. The fluid is considered as an incompressible viscous Newtonian fluid whose viscosity, at each temperature, is a function of the advancement of the polymerization reaction (conversion rate) ; moreover, the shear rate is negligible because the rotation speed is low (1 to 10 rpm). The result of interest is the displacement of the free surface as a function of time which is governed by the competition of two main forces, gravity and viscosity.
